{television} numbers; season one (2005)

FBI agent Don Eppes (Rob Morrow) recruits his math whiz brother Charlie (David Krumholtz) to help solve some of the bureau's most challenging crimes. Despite their radically different approaches to life and work, when the two combine their skills they become a brilliant crime-fighting machine. Inspired by true-life cases, this fascinating TV series explores the details of criminal investigation and the crucial role mathematics can play.

ireviewnetflix.com rating: *** It's an all right show. A little slow for my liking. It had some great episode and some just all right episodes. For the most part though, it was background noise. I will, however, check out season two as I'm told by a friend that while it started out a little slow it gets better.
